This past weekend the annual Met Gala, formally called the Costume Institute Gala, was held at the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York City. This annual event is held for the benefit of The Metropolitan Museum of Art’s Costume Institute. While this has always been a fundraising event, it has always also been a night of celebrity and stellar fashion. This particular red carpet allows stylists to be much more daring than say the Oscars, but also much more editorial than the Grammy Awards. This is where you will often see some of the most serious fashion statements of the year.
Every year there is a theme and stylists are encouraged to create looks that go along with that theme. This year’s theme was Manus x Machina: Fashion in the Age of Technology.
